Example Code

import typer
from typing import Optionaldef main(name: Optional[str] = typer.Argument(None)):
   if name:
       typer.echo(f'Name: {name}')

if __name__ == '__main__':
    typer.run(main)

Description

For optional arguments Typer shows their metavar instead of type in argument help. For above example instead of TEXT we get [NAME] in argument help.
